Testovanie odolnosti pre platformy s viacerými nájomcami s chybami používateľov
Testovanie odolnosti pre platformy s viacerými nájomcami s používateľskými zlyhaniami je navrhnuté tak, aby simulovalo vysoký objem súbežných zlyhaní používateľov naprieč viacerými nájomcami, čím sa zabezpečuje, že vaša platforma zostáva stabilná a reagujúca aj za náročných podmienok. Použitím <a href="https://loadfocus.com/load-testing">nástroja/služby LoadFocus Load Testing</a> môžete simulovať tisíce virtuálnych používateľov z viac ako 26 cloudových regiónov, testujúc schopnosť vášho systému zotaviť sa zo zlyhaní používateľov a zabezpečujúc, že spĺňa požiadavky na spoľahlivosť potrebné pre prostredia s viacerými nájomcami.
Čo je testovanie odolnosti pre platformy s viacerými nájomcami?
Testovanie odolnosti pre platformy s viacerými nájomcami so zlyhaniami používateľov sa zameriava na hodnotenie stability a spoľahlivosti vašej platformy, keď používatelia z rôznych nájomcov zažívajú zlyhania súčasne. Táto šablóna sa podrobne zaoberá tým, ako vytvoriť scenáre zlyhania a merať obnovu systému. Pomocou LoadFocus (Služba testovania zaťaženia LoadFocus) môžete vykonávať testy odolnosti s tisíckami virtuálnych súbežných používateľov z viac ako 26 cloudových regiónov. To zabezpečuje, že vaša platforma s viacerými nájomcami dokáže zvládnuť zlyhania používateľov vo veľkom rozsahu bez degradácie služieb.
Táto šablóna vám pomôže posúdiť, ako vaša platforma reaguje na súbežné zlyhania používateľov, pričom zabezpečuje, že problémy sú izolované, mechanizmy obnovy sú na mieste a výkon je udržiavaný pod zaťažením.
Ako táto šablóna pomáha?
Naša šablóna vás prevedie nastavením a konfiguráciou testov odolnosti, ktoré simulujú zlyhania používateľov v prostredí s viacerými nájomcami. Pokrýva osvedčené postupy pre testovanie robustnosti systému pod zaťažením, čím zabezpečuje, že vaša platforma sa dokáže elegantne obnoviť a udržať svoje záväzky SLA.
Prečo potrebujeme testovanie odolnosti pre platformy s viacerými nájomcami?
Bez riadneho testovania odolnosti môžu platformy s viacerými nájomcami trpieť kaskádovými zlyhaniami, ktoré ovplyvňujú viacerých nájomcov súčasne. Táto šablóna zdôrazňuje, ako izolovať problémy, zmierniť riziká a optimalizovať stratégie obnovy, čím zabezpečuje, že vaša platforma poskytuje nepretržitú službu aj počas kritických zlyhaní.
- Testovanie stability platformy: Zabezpečte, aby bola stabilita platformy udržiavaná, keď viacerí nájomcovia zažívajú zlyhania.
- Optimalizácia obnovy: Vyhodnoťte, ako efektívne sa vaša platforma obnovuje zo zlyhaní a obnovuje služby.
- Zabezpečenie škálovateľnosti: Overte, či vaša platforma dokáže zvládnuť rastúci počet súbežných zlyhaní bez degradácie výkonu.
Ako funguje testovanie odolnosti pre platformy s viacerými nájomcami
Táto šablóna definuje, ako simulovať viaceré zlyhania používateľov naprieč rôznymi nájomcami pri monitorovaní mechanizmov obnovy platformy. Využitím nástrojov LoadFocus môžete vytvoriť realistické scenáre zlyhania, otestovať odolnosť vášho systému a monitorovať jeho správanie pod stresom.
Základy tejto šablóny
Šablóna obsahuje scenáre zlyhania, monitorovacie stratégie a osvedčené postupy na konfiguráciu testov odolnosti. LoadFocus sa bezproblémovo integruje s vašou platformou, aby poskytoval real-time panely, upozornenia a prehľady o výkone systému počas testov.
Kľúčové komponenty
1. Návrh scenára zlyhania
Vytvorte scenáre zlyhania používateľov, ktoré napodobňujú situácie zo skutočného sveta, vrátane výpadkov siete, nedostupnosti služieb a zlyhaní systému.
2. Simulácia virtuálnych používateľov
Simulujte vysoký objem virtuálnych používateľov naprieč viacerými nájomcami. LoadFocus vám pomôže škálovať vaše testy na simuláciu tisícov súbežných zlyhaní.
3. Sledovanie výkonových metrík
Sledujte kľúčové výkonové indikátory, ako sú časy odozvy systému, rýchlosť obnovy a dopad zlyhania naprieč nájomcami. Šablóna vás vedie pri nastavovaní realistických prahových hodnôt výkonu.
4. Upozornenia a notifikácie
Naučte sa konfigurovať upozornenia na monitorovanie správania systému počas fáz zlyhania a obnovy. Môžete dostávať notifikácie prostredníctvom e-mailu, SMS alebo Slacku, keď sa vyskytnú problémy.
5. Analýza výsledkov
Akonáhle sú testy dokončené, použite LoadFocus správy na analýzu efektívnosti mechanizmov obnovy vašej platformy a identifikáciu oblastí na zlepšenie.
Vizualizácia zlyhaní používateľov a obnovy
Predstavte si scenár, kde používatelia naprieč viacerými nájomcami zažívajú zlyhania súčasne. Táto šablóna ukazuje, ako vizualizácie LoadFocus zvýrazňujú výkon obnovy, dopad zlyhania a zdravie systému počas testu.
Akoé typy testov odolnosti existujú?
Táto šablóna pokrýva rôzne metódy testovania odolnosti, aby zabezpečila, že vaša platforma dokáže zvládnuť zlyhania používateľov aj výpadky systému bez ohrozenia služby.
Testovanie záťaže
Posuňte svoju platformu za typické scenáre zlyhania, aby ste identifikovali úzke miesta v obnove a potenciálne body zlyhania.
Testovanie špičky
Simulujte náhle nárasty zlyhaní, ako napríklad počas aktualizácií systému, aby ste otestovali, ako rýchlo sa vaša platforma dokáže zotaviť z neočakávaných špičiek zlyhania.
Testovanie vytrvalosti
Testujte, ako dobre vaša platforma dokáže zvládnuť predĺžené obdobia zlyhaní používateľov a obnovy počas dlhších období.
Testovanie škálovateľnosti
Postupne zvyšujte počet zlyhaní, aby ste vyhodnotili, ako sa váš systém škáluje pod ťažkými zaťaženiami a aby ste našli akékoľvek obmedzenia zdrojov počas obnovy.
Testovanie objemu
Zamerajte sa na testovanie schopnosti platformy zvládnuť veľké objemy súbežných zlyhaní používateľov bez ovplyvnenia celkového výkonu systému.
Rámce testovania zaťaženia pre odolnosť
Táto šablóna je kompatibilná s rôznymi nástrojmi na testovanie zaťaženia, ale LoadFocus ponúka bezproblémovú integráciu pre testovanie odolnosti s viacerými nájomcami, poskytujúc komplexné údaje o výkone a zjednodušujúc vykonávanie testov naprieč rôznymi cloudovými regiónmi.
Monitorovanie vašich testov odolnosti
Monitorovanie v reálnom čase počas testovania odolnosti je kľúčové na identifikáciu slabých miest a overenie postupov obnovy. LoadFocus poskytuje sledovanie výkonu v reálnom čase, čo vám umožňuje detekovať problémy a okamžite posúdiť dopad zlyhaní naprieč nájomcami.
Dôležitosť tejto šablóny pre spoľahlivosť vašej platformy
Pri platformách s viacerými nájomcami sú riziká súbežných zlyhaní vyššie. Táto šablóna zabezpečuje, že vaša platforma dokáže zvládnuť zlyhania používateľov vo veľkom rozsahu, efektívne sa obnoviť a udržať spoľahlivosť pre všetkých nájomcov počas vrcholových scenárov zlyhania.
Kritické metriky na sledovanie
- Čas obnovy po zlyhaní: Zmerajte, ako rýchlo sa vaša platforma zotavuje zo zlyhaní.
- Dopad na ostatných nájomcov: Monitorujte, ako zlyhania v jednom nájomcovi ovplyvňujú výkon ostatných.
- Latencia systému počas zlyhaní: Sledovanie oneskorení v dodávke služieb počas udalostí zlyhania.
- Využitie zdrojov: Monitorujte využitie zdrojov, vrátane CPU, pamäte a diskového I/O počas obnovy po zlyhaní.
Akoé sú osvedčené postupy pre túto šablónu?
- Simulujte rôzne scenáre zlyhania: Testujte rôzne podmienky zlyhania, aby ste identifikovali slabé miesta a optimalizovali obnovu.
- Testujte naprieč viacerými nájomcami: Zabezpečte, aby zlyhania v jednom nájomcovi neovplyvnili ostatných.
- Postupne zvyšujte zaťaženie: Začnite s niekoľkými zlyhaniami a postupne zvyšujte zaťaženie, aby ste otestovali škálovateľnosť vašej platformy počas obnovy.
- Monitorujte využitie zdrojov: Zabezpečte, aby obmedzenia zdrojov nebránili obnove počas vysokých zlyhaní.
- Zapojte všetky tímy: Zdieľajte výsledky s vývojármi, QA a prevádzkovými tímami na zlepšenie spoľahlivosti platformy.
Výhody používania tejto šablóny
Včasná detekcia problémov
Identifikujte problémy s obnovou skôr, než ovplyvnia vašich používateľov, a zmiernite riziko rozsiahlych zlyhaní.
Optimalizácia výkonu
Zlepšite výkon platformy riešením úzkych miest v obnove a zlepšením procesov správy zlyhaní.
Stabilita platformy
Zabezpečte, aby vaša platforma s viacerými nájomcami zostala stabilná a reagovala aj v najnáročnejších podmienkach zlyhania používateľov.
Škálovateľná odolnosť
Testujte schopnosť platformy škálovať svoje mechanizmy obnovy, keď sa zvyšuje zaťaženie zlyhaním.
Informácie v reálnom čase
Získajte podrobné informácie v reálnom čase počas scenárov zlyhania, čo vám umožní rýchlo konať a minimalizovať prestoje.
Kontinuálne testovanie odolnosti - pretrvávajúca potreba
Táto šablóna je určená na kontinuálne testovanie. Platformy sa vyvíjajú, vzory zlyhania sa menia a procesy obnovy si vyžadujú neustálu validáciu. Kontinuálne testovanie odolnosti zabezpečuje, že vaša platforma zostáva stabilná pod meniacimi sa podmienkami.
Konzistentná stabilita
Používajte menšie, častejšie testy na validáciu mechanizmov obnovy s každým novým vydaním funkcie alebo aktualizáciou.
Proaktívne riešenie zlyhaní
Riešte zlyhania proaktívne, aby ste sa vyhli väčším problémom počas vrcholových udalostí zlyhania používateľov.
Škálovateľnosť platformy
Ako sa vaša platforma škáluje, zabezpečte, aby mechanizmy odolnosti zostali účinné pri zvyšujúcich sa zlyhaniach používateľov.
Reakcia na incidenty v reálnom čase
Využite výsledky testov na optimalizáciu reakcie na incidenty a protokolov obnovy.
Prípadové štúdie testovania odolnosti
Táto šablóna je cenná pre akúkoľvek platformu s viacerými nájomcami, kde zlyhania môžu ovplyvniť viacerých používateľov súčasne:
Cloudové SaaS platformy
- Výpadky platformy: Testujte, ako sa vaša platforma zotavuje z výpadkov služieb, ktoré ovplyvňujú viacerých nájomcov.
- Zlyhania modelu predplatného: Simulujte zlyhania počas obnovy predplatného, aby ste zabezpečili stabilitu nájomcov.
Prostredia s viacerými nájomcami
- Zlyhania alokácie zdrojov: Testujte, ako zlyhania v používaní jedného nájomcu ovplyvňujú celkové hostingové prostredie.
Zdieľané dátové platformy
- Korupcia alebo strata dát: Zabezpečte, aby dáta zostali konzistentné naprieč nájomcami po obnove zo zlyhaní.
Začiatok s touto šablónou
Skopírujte alebo importujte túto šablónu do vášho projektu LoadFocus, aby ste začali s testovaním odolnosti. Nakonfigurujte scenáre zlyhania, nastavte úrovne zaťaženia a začnite simulovať zlyhania používateľov zo skutočného sveta.
Prečo používať LoadFocus s touto šablónou?
- Viaceré cloudové regióny: Testujte z viac ako 26 regiónov pre presnú, celosvetovú viditeľnosť výkonu.
- Škálovateľnosť: Bez námahy simulujte tisíce súbežných zlyhaní používateľov.
- Komplexná analýza: Sledovanie času obnovy, zdravia systému a výkonových metrík v reálnom čase.
- Jednoduchá integrácia: Integrujte testovanie odolnosti do vášho CI/CD pipeline pre neustále testovanie spoľahlivosti.
Záverečné myšlienky
Táto šablóna vám poskytuje štruktúrovaný prístup k testovaniu odolnosti vašej platformy s viacerými nájomcami pod scenármi zlyhania používateľov. S LoadFocus Load Testing môžete zabezpečiť, že vaša platforma zostane stabilná, škálovateľná a vysoko dostupná, aj v najnáročnejších podmienkach.
Často kladené otázky o testovaní odolnosti pre platformy s viacerými nájomcami
Akoý je cieľ testovania odolnosti pre platformy s viacerými nájomcami?
Cieľom je zabezpečiť, aby vaša platforma dokázala udržať stabilitu a efektívne sa obnoviť, keď viacerí nájomcovia zažívajú zlyhania.
Môžem prispôsobiť šablónu pre rôzne scenáre zlyhania?
Áno, táto šablóna umožňuje prispôsobenie, aby odrážala rôzne scenáre zlyhania jedinečné pre vašu platformu.
Ako často by som mal vykonávať testy odolnosti?
Testy odolnosti by sa mali vykonávať pravidelne, najmä pri zavádzaní nových funkcií alebo škálovaní vašej platformy.
Akoé metriky by som mal sledovať počas testovania odolnosti?
Kľúčové metriky zahŕňajú čas obnovy, dopad zlyhania na ostatných nájomcov, latenciu systému a využitie zdrojov počas obnovy.
Ako LoadFocus podporuje testovanie odolnosti s viacerými nájomcami?
Pomocou LoadFocus môžete simulovať zlyhania naprieč viacerými nájomcami, škálovať testy globálne a sledovať podrobné výkonové metriky v reálnom čase.
Ako rýchlo je vaša webová stránka?
Zvýšte jeho rýchlosť a SEO bez problémov s našim Bezplatným Testom Rýchlosti.Zaslúžiš si lepšie testovacie služby
Cloudové testovacie služby a nástroje pre webové stránky a rozhrania APIZačať testovať teraz→